Automated grounding line delineation using deep learning and phase gradient-based approaches on COSMO-SkyMed DInSAR data
The grounding line marks the transition between a glacier's floating and grounded parts and serves as a crucial parameter for monitoring sea level changes and assessing glacier retreat. The Differential Interferometric Synthetic Aperture Radar (DInSAR) technique for grounding line mapping curre...
